Transaction af33521ce7608432436339ed5f511974b3dfeffb772cb2b3f367aee10ac2613c
1 Input
2 Outputs
- af33521ce7608432436339ed5f511974b3dfeffb772cb2b3f367aee10ac2613c:0
- af33521ce7608432436339ed5f511974b3dfeffb772cb2b3f367aee10ac2613c:1
value 215039973
address 3JFkUExfFbq1jcRmDFgSAWAT9jdZUiMW8p
value 284915492
address 1PaWnbnTkid731GY4snQeB1ez1ZsXiuJVF